averainy's Blog

averainy

04 Mar 2022

使用virt-install创建kvm虚拟机

终端命令行使用virt-install 创建win10虚拟机大概流程如下:

创建虚拟硬盘

qemu-img create -f qcow2 /home/kvm/data/win10_test/win10_test.img 40G 

创建虚拟机

virt-install --virt-type kvm \ #虚拟机类型kvm
--name win10_test \ #虚拟机名字
--memory 10240 \ #内存10240M
--cdrom=/home/kvm/data/isos/Win10_21H2_Japanese_x64.iso \ #cdrom镜像路径
--boot cdrom \ #从cdrom启动
--disk path=/home/kvm/data/win10_test/win10_test.img,bus=sata  \ #虚拟磁盘路径 总线是sata,安装好之后可以通过安装virtio驱动这样性能会更好。
--cpu host-model-only \ #cpu类型跟宿主机一样
--network=default,model='e1000' \ #默认网络,网卡位e1000,等安装好之后可以通过安装virtio驱动以提高性能
--graphics vnc,listen=0.0.0.0 \ #vnc监听所有网卡,vnc端口随机
--vcpus 5 \ #虚拟cpu内核数为5
--noautoconsole \ #不自动打开控制台
--os-variant win10 \ #虚拟机类型为win10,装什么系统就选哪个,尽量一致或相近,以提高性能。

Categories

Tags